What makes the house more expensive to build?

There are a number of factors that can contribute to the cost of building a house. Some of the most significant factors include:

7 bedroom house
Source

Location

The cost of building a 7-bedroom house floor plans can vary significantly depending on where it is located. In general, building a house in an urban area is more expensive than building in a rural area due to higher land costs and the need to adhere to stricter building codes and regulations.

Size

The size of the house is a major factor in the cost of construction. Larger houses require more materials and labour to build and therefore tend to be more expensive.

Materials

The cost of building a house can also be influenced by the materials used. Some materials, such as brick or stone, are more expensive than others, such as vinyl siding.

Permits and fees

Building a house often requires obtaining various permits and paying fees to local government agencies. These costs can vary depending on the location and type of house being built. The actual cost of these fees can vary depending on a variety of factors.

FeesDescriptionPotential Cost Increase
PermitsBuilding a house often requires obtaining various permits from local government agencies. These permits may be based on the size and type of house being built and can vary significantly in cost.Varies
Impact feesImpact fees are charges assessed by local governments to cover the cost of new infrastructure needed to support new development. These fees can vary depending on the location and type of house being built.Varies
Development feesDevelopment fees are charges assessed by local governments to cover the cost of the new infrastructure needed to support new development. These fees can vary depending on the location and the type of house being built.Varies
Building inspectionsBuilding inspections are often required during the construction process to ensure that the house is being built to code. These inspections may incur a fee.Low to moderate

What makes the house affordable to build?

Some strategies that can help to reduce the cost of building a house include:

Choosing a more efficient layout

Building a smaller house or one with a more efficient layout can help to reduce the overall cost of construction.

Using less expensive materials 

Materials such as vinyl siding instead of brick or wood can help to reduce the cost of building a house.

Selecting basic finishes

Choosing basic finishes, such as laminate countertops and vinyl flooring, can also help to reduce the overall cost of construction.

Building in a less expensive location

A Location such as a rural area instead of an urban area can help to reduce the cost of building a house.

Seeking out cost-saving opportunities

There may be opportunities to save on the cost of building a house by negotiating with contractors or suppliers, or by opting for value engineering options that can reduce the cost of certain materials or systems.

What are the structural details of the house?

These elements include:

Foundation: The foundation of a house is the part of the structure that sits on the ground and supports the weight of the house. It is typically made of concrete and is designed to transfer the load of the house to the ground.

Walls: The walls of a house are the vertical elements that make up the structure of the house. They may be made of a variety of materials, such as wood, brick, or concrete, and are designed to support the weight of the roof and the upper floors of the house.

Roof: The roof of a house is the structure that covers the top of the house and protects it from the elements. It is typically made of wood, metal, or asphalt and is supported by the walls and trusses of the house.

Trusses: Trusses are structural elements that are used to support the roof of a house. They are typically made of wood or metal and are designed to distribute the load of the roof evenly across the walls of the house.

Beams: Beams are structural elements that are used to support the weight of the house. They may be made of wood, steel, or concrete and are used to transfer the load of the house to the foundation.

Disadvantages of 7 bedroom house

Cost

A 7 bedroom house may be more expensive to purchase and maintain than a smaller house due to its size and the additional amenities it may have.

Energy efficiency

A 7 bedroom house may be less energy efficient than a smaller house due to its larger size and the additional heating and cooling requirements.

Maintenance

A 7 bedroom house may require more maintenance due to its size and the additional features it may have.

Property taxes

A 7 bedroom house may have higher property taxes due to its larger size and value.

Difficulty in furnishing

It may be more challenging to furnish and decorate a 7 bedroom house than a smaller home.

Difficulty in finding tenants or buyers

Depending on the location and other factors, it may be more difficult to find tenants or buyers for a 7 bedroom house than for a smaller home.
